In the ever-expanding world of forex, crypto, and stock trading, traders are always on the lookout for reliable brokers. However, recent findings suggest that not all glitters are gold. WiseMarket, a broker that gained traction through promising ads and its association with the Fira indicator, might not be as reliable as it seems.
WiseMarket has been in the limelight recently for its aggressive marketing on social media platforms, promising guaranteed profits with the help of the Fira indicator. However, Fira is not a proprietary tool of WiseMarket but is operated by a third party.

The spotlight turned sour when a trader voiced concerns about WiseMarket's withdrawal process. He highlighted that the broker has held back his withdrawal request for over four months, only to respond with repetitive emails. This wasn't an isolated case, as other traders shared similar experiences. These consistent patterns hint at a potential misuse of trader funds.
While WiseMarket's operations don't scream “Ponzi Scheme,” their approach mirrors many scam brokers that entice people to invest using such strategies. With the Fira indicator as bait, they may have lured many unsuspecting traders.

To compound the concerns, it seems WiseMarket may not be as regulated as they claim. While they profess to be incorporated in Saint Vincent And Grenadines, the SVGFSA website clearly states that forex trading brokerage activities are not licensed in the region. This discrepancy is a red flag for anyone considering investing with them.
